Pentiums Posted April 24, 2009 Report Share Posted April 24, 2009 Labdien. Man jautājumi daži par mysql_close PHP funkciju. 1. Vai to lietot ir rekomendējams un kā ir labāk? 2. Vai nākamās lapas ielādes laiks nepalielinās ar šīs fjas lietošanu? 3. Un vai to nelietojot pie bieža lapas apmeklējumu skaita var dabūt erroru "Could not connect to SQL database. Too many connections."?? Paldies. Quote Link to comment Share on other sites More sharing options...
marcis Posted April 24, 2009 Report Share Posted April 24, 2009 1. Nav obligāti, php pats aizver konekciju, kad skripts ir izpildījies. 2. Nē, izlasām vēlreiz pirmo punktu. Konekcija tiek aizvērta jebkurā gadījumā. 3. Tas pats pirmais punkts. Nekādas atšķirības, rakstot manuāli mysql_close() vai astājot to paša php ziņā. Quote Link to comment Share on other sites More sharing options...
Pentiums Posted April 24, 2009 Author Report Share Posted April 24, 2009 tad kam viņa vispār ir nepieciešama? Quote Link to comment Share on other sites More sharing options...
marcis Posted April 24, 2009 Report Share Posted April 24, 2009 Ir situācijas, kad noder. Quote Link to comment Share on other sites More sharing options...
rausis Posted April 24, 2009 Report Share Posted April 24, 2009 priekš mysql_pconnect itkā to close vajag, jo tas pats neaizver savienojumu pēc izpildes, nu vismaz tā rakstīts manuālī.. Quote Link to comment Share on other sites More sharing options...
Klez Posted April 27, 2009 Report Share Posted April 27, 2009 close var izmantot gadījumā ja no db vajag datus un pēc tam tos apstrādāt. piemēram: panjemam no db lietotaaja info select * from tabula where kkas=1 //te var taisiit mysql_close un tālāk jau php apstrādā datus ... veic aprēķinu ... bet ja lapai nav milziiga noslodze tad to nemaz nejutiis .. Quote Link to comment Share on other sites More sharing options...
daGrevis Posted April 27, 2009 Report Share Posted April 27, 2009 Paldies par info, noderēs. Man arī bija šāds jautajums. Quote Link to comment Share on other sites More sharing options...
web-dev.lv Posted April 29, 2009 Report Share Posted April 29, 2009 mysql_close() arī bieži izmanto datu migrācijai no vienas datubāzes uz citu pieslēdzamies serverim selektējam nepieciešamos datus datu apstrāde atlēdzamies no servera pielsēdzamies jaunajam serverim liekam datus iekšā jaunā serveri atslēdzamies Quote Link to comment Share on other sites More sharing options...
nemec Posted April 29, 2009 Report Share Posted April 29, 2009 web-dev.lv, bez problēmām var darboties vienlaicīgi ar divām datubāzēm (da kaut vai ar 10). Tāpēc pielietojumu tam lielu šeit neredzu. uz 2006 erroru mysql gone away, aiztaisam konekciju, un tad piekonektējamies no jauna. Bet tas atkal attiecās uz gadījumiem, kad konekcija tiek turēta ilgu laiku. Jo pēc noklusējuma, mysqls tur 2 stundas (laikam) konekciju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.